The Siemens 3RK1301-0CB13-1AA4 is a SIMATIC-brand reversing motor starter — a single device that handles forward and reverse motor direction without external contactors or a separate reversing assembly. It's designed for the Siemens automation ecosystem, with native PROFINET and PROFIBUS DP protocols for direct fieldbus integration into a PLC or safety CPU. The overload protection is adjustable between trip Class 10 and Class 20, so you can tune the thermal curve to match the motor start profile — Class 10 for fast-starting pumps and fans, Class 20 for high-inertia loads like conveyors or crushers that need a longer acceleration ramp.

Reliability and safety metrics for spares and SIL planning

MTBF of 11 a gives the MRO planner a mean-time-between-failure figure for spares provisioning — roughly one failure per decade per unit under normal operation. The MTTFd of 31 a is the safety-related failure rate used in SIL (Safety Integrity Level) calculations per IEC 61508, which matters when this starter is part of a safety function circuit. The safe state is defined as load circuit open — meaning on loss of supply or fault, the output contacts open and the motor coasts to stop. This is the expected fail-safe behavior for a motor starter in a guarding or emergency-stop chain.

Installation and environmental fit

Mounts by plugging onto a terminal module — no hardwiring of the base unit, which cuts panel assembly time and simplifies swap-out. Acceptable in vertical or horizontal orientation, so it fits tight enclosures where space is constrained. Dimensions are 130 mm wide, 150 mm deep, 290 mm tall — a compact footprint for a reversing starter with integrated fieldbus. Pollution degree 3 at 400 V and degree 2 at 500 V per IEC 60664 / IEC 61131 — the higher degree 3 rating means it's designed for industrial environments with conductive dust or occasional condensation, without needing additional conformal coating on the PCB.

Supply voltage and control logic

Control supply is 24 V DC nominal, with a permissible range of 20.4 to 28.8 V DC — standard for industrial 24 V panels. The rated value is 24 V, and the operating range is 21.6 to 26.4 V DC. Two digital inputs are available for control signals (forward/reverse commands), addressed via the fieldbus as 2 bytes of input and 2 bytes of output data. Supports reverse starting (reversing function) but not direct-on-line starting — the reversing logic is built in. Maximum operating frequency is 80 operations per hour, so it's suited for cyclic applications but not high-speed reversing.
